Event description: 

Given a closed subvariety of an algebraic torus, the associated
tropical variety is a polyhedral fan in the space of 1-parameter subgroups of the torus which describes the behaviour of the subvariety at infinity. We give a geometric interpretation of the tropical variety (following E. Tevelev) and, at least in generic cases, we show that the link of the origin has only top rational homology.
